ESPN Pac-12 Picks Split Between USC, Oregon

Even with the No. 1 ranking coming into the season, there are still a few doubters of the USC Trojans ability to win the Pac-12, let alone a national title. Eighteen college football analysts from ESPN were almost split down the middle in terms of the Pac-12 championship, with USC gaining 10 votes and the Oregon Ducks receiving the other eight votes.

It was the closest races out of the all of the conference predictions, which is surprising considering the profile of USC heading into the season. But the Trojans were selected in two of the three top vote-getters for the BCS National Championship game pairings with tops being the No. 2 Alabama Crimson Tide vs. No. 5 Oregon, No. 3 LSU Tigers vs. No. 1 USC and No. 2 Alabama vs. No. 1 USC.

It looks like ESPN sees this season as a battle between the Pac-12 and the SEC with Alabama, LSU and Georgia all vying to come out of the conference responsible for the last six BCS National Championships.
